GovAI Hires Researchers to Study AI Regulation and Threat Models
Manderljung · x · 2026-08-15
GovAI is accepting applications for Research Scholar and Research Fellow roles, closing Sunday midnight AoE. The roles involve rigorous research to inform high-stakes AI decisions. Key responsibilities include engaging with companies and governments on frontier AI regulation implementation, producing detailed cyber and CBRN threat models, developing "proto-standards" for frontier AI companies, studying AI's economic impacts, and figuring out how frontier AI companies should track progress in AI R&D automation.
